Each run of the color-contrast accessibility audit produces a results bundle containing the contrast report, the page inventory, and the remediation checklist. Because these bundles feed compliance attestations, they must be tamper-evident. The pipeline hashes the bundle, embeds the hash in the manifest, and signs the manifest before archival. Reviewers should verify the signature against the manifest prior to accepting any findings. For reproducibility, sign the manifest with the audit release key below.

release key, kawif-hawep: bky13_X7TGuRG4Zu4ZJ

Ticket: Staging env misconfigured for Siftgate bloom filter

The bloom layer in front of the Pellet KV store is rejecting all lookups in staging because the env file was copied from the dev template without credentials. False-positive tuning values are fine; only the auth line is missing. To unblock the weekly demo, the Pellet admission secret must be set on the following line.

env line for yaguf-fajop: LEDGER_TOKEN13=fb08984397349

### Step 4: Cut over the proctoring queue

Drain VigilQueue on the old Harrowfield cluster. Verify no exam sessions remain in-flight. Point the intake workers at the new broker and re-enable admission. Session tokens are re-signed on cutover; old ones are rejected by design. Confirm the audit log is receiving events before proceeding. The new broker applies the following configuration values.

settings of yageg-yahap:
[gorael]
team = olieth
access_code = ac_941d74
owner = brieth.aldiel
host = gorael.tolvaqio.internal
port = 6379
peer = briwyn.urlaqtech.internal
salt = 116e6622
pin = 1957